(C) Given,


Observations are = 1, 3, 5, 7, 5, 2, 7, 5, 9, 3, p, 11


Mode = 5


Value of p = 7


We know that mode is the item which has highest frequency and in given statement 5 is the mode. If p = 7 then it will become the number with highest frequency. It means p can’t be equals to 7 as mode is 5.


So, the given statement is false.


(D) Given;


Mean of 10 observations = 15


Mean of 15 observations = 18


Mean of all 25 observation = 16.8


Now the sum of the observations;


Sum of 10 observations = 10 × 15 = 150


Sum of 15 observation = 15 × 18 = 270


Sum of 25 observation = Sum of 10 observations + Sum of 15 observations
